である。DETAILED DESCRIPTION OF THE INVENTION Field of Industrial Application The present invention relates to a binding band that can be used for bundling electrical wires and insulating electrical components of consumer electronic products.

る為に、結束帯や粘着テープを使用している。2. Description of the Related Art In general, consumer electrical products use binding bands or adhesive tapes to bind multiple electrical wires together.
以下図面を参照しながら従来の結束帯について説明する
。第4図は従来の結束帯の代表例を示す。The conventional binding belt will be explained below with reference to the drawings. FIG. 4 shows a typical example of a conventional binding band.

係合孔2に挿入されると抜は難くなっている。In FIG. 4, reference numeral 1 denotes a band-shaped body made of a flexible synthetic resin material, and one end of which is provided with a retaining hole 2 into which the other end of the band-shaped body is inserted. In use, as shown in FIG. 4, after the outer periphery of a plurality of wire rods 3 to be bundled is wound around the band 1, the other end of the band 1 is passed through the retaining hole 2 and bundled. . At this time, a plurality of notches 1& are provided on both side edges near the other end of the strip 1, making it difficult to remove once inserted into the engagement hole 2.

だがあった。Problems to be Solved by the Invention However, in the conventional configuration, since a retaining hole 2 is required at one end of the strip 1, a plurality of strips 1 having different lengths may be bundled depending on the amount of wire rods 3 to be bundled. Otherwise, it is necessary to prepare the band-like body 1 in advance, or it is necessary to configure the band-like body 1 to be long and cut off the end portion that is no longer needed after binding, resulting in wasted material.

のである。Means for Solving the Problems In order to solve the above-mentioned problems, the bundle of the present invention has an engagement recess and an engagement recess that presses the front of the engagement recess into a band-like body made of a flexible insulating material. The convex portions are arranged alternately at predetermined intervals.

のである。Function According to the above structure, since the wire rods, etc. can be cut and used according to the amount of wire rods, etc. to be bundled at the time of use, there is no need to prepare multiple types depending on the amount of bundles, and there is no need to waste materials. .

状体4の幅方向に設けられたV字状の切欠溝である。Embodiment FIG. 2 shows a sketch of a binding band according to an embodiment of the present invention. In FIG. 2, reference numeral 4 denotes a band-shaped body made of an insulating material such as synthetic resin, and an engagement recess 5 and an engagement protrusion e that engages with the engagement recess 5 are predetermined on the edge thereof. The engaging concave portions 5 and the convex portions 6 are arranged in sequence at a distance apart from each other, and the positions of the engaging recesses 5 and the convex portions 6 are reversed on both side edges. Reference numeral 7 denotes a V-shaped notch groove provided in the width direction of the band-shaped body 4 at an intermediate portion between the engagement recess 6 and the protrusion 6.

性を増加せしめる働きをする。Figure 1 shows its usage. That is, the wire rods 3 are cut along the V groove 7 according to the amount of wire rods 3 to be bundled, and after the wire rods 3 are wound, the engaging recess 5 and the protrusion 6 are engaged to complete the binding. The grooves 7 serve to increase the substantial flexibility of the strip 1.

とができる。When the amount of wire rods 3 is large, as shown in FIG. 3, the four engaging concave portions 6 and the convex portions 6 are engaged with each other to achieve a stronger binding.

要もなく、材料のむだも発生しないものである。Effects of the Invention As described above, the length of the cable tie of the present invention can be easily set as required, so there is no need to prepare cable ties of various lengths, and unnecessary ends can be saved. There is no need to cut or remove the material, and no material is wasted.
